According to Ruiz & Brescovit (2008) , the male H. albovittata (Figure 3C) is easily distinguished from other Helvetia species by the very long embolus, the form of the RTA and the presence of a depression on the retrolateral cymbium where the tip of the embolus is held in resting position (see Bedoya-Roqueme et al. 2018 , figs. 6-11). Natural history . The habitats of this species appear to be very diverse. The specimens of H. albovittata from Colombia have been found in mangrove forests and humid forests. Here we report a male from humid forest. Distribution . Argentina , Brazil , Colombia , Galapagos Islands, Netherlands Antilles , Paraguay .
